18th Century French Oak Winged Cherub Carving on Stand
Located in Dallas, TX
This detailed winged cherub face is surrounded by stylized foliate wings. Hand carved in France, circa 1750, the oak wood has been bleached at some point, revealing beautiful wood grain. The back of the carving reveals an interesting series of architectural moldings, indicating that this was once part of a larger installation which would have been viewable from the back. Oak was the preferred wood for crafting furniture and carving up until the 1700’s. The wood is strong and sturdy, ensuring that pieces would endure. These qualities also make it difficult to carve, indicating that our cherub was created by someone with great skill. Mid-17th Century Portuguese Carved Reliquary Bust of "Saint Margaret of Antioch"
Located in Dallas, TX
This antique bust of "Margaret the Virgin" was created in Portugal circa 1660. The saint, with the original polychromed and gilt finish, houses a small relic, a piece of hand-sewn fabric on the front of the bust by Margaret's heart, protected with glass. The fabric is rhombus-shaped with a scalloped edge, and showcases an intricately stitched, small, shining heart which appears to be bleeding next to a long floral branch. Margaret herself is depicted wearing a serene expression and a headpiece which fully covers her hair. Her arms cross in front of her and it appears as if there were once hands attached to the ends of them which have been lost.
